He is amongst the artists in the genres of Punjabi singing and songwriting. In 2017, he released his debut single, "Pind Di Kudi", which earned him significant popularity. His second song, "Sohni Lagdi", created a buzz among the audience. He has released various hit singles and albums, such as "Jatt Da Style" and "Tere Naal". These have earned millions of views on social media. He has produced numerous songs and collaborated with notable artists, including Byg Bryd, D Harp, Tarna, and many others. He also made a world record for being the youngest Music Director in India for the Punjabi Song “Gulabi Note”.
